shift命令改变可替换参数的在批处理程序的位置。
查看英文版
1 shift 运行系统环境
2 shift 语法
3 shift 示例
Windows 95
Windows 98
Windows xp
Windows vista
Windows 2000
Windows 7
Windows 8
Windows 10
Windows NT
Windows ME
MS-DOS 3.00及以上
Windows 2000, Windows XP, 及更高版本的语法
更改批处理文件中可替换参数的位置。
SHIFT [/n]
如果启用了命令扩展,则SHIFT命令支持/ n开关,该开关告诉命令在第n个参数处开始移位,其中n可以介于零和八之间。下面的命令会将%3转移到%2,将%4转移到%3,依此类推,而不会影响%0和%1。
SHIFT /2
Windows 95,Windows 98和Windows ME的语法
更改批处理文件中可替换参数的位置。
SHIFT
查看英文版
下面的示例将在批处理文件中完成;在此示例中,我们将命名批处理文件test.bat,其中包含以下几行。
@ECHO OFF ECHO - %1 SHIFT ECHO - %1
创建上面显示的示例test.bat文件后,如果要在MS-DOS提示符下键入以下命令,它将打印“-ONE”,然后“-TWO”。该命令通常用于遍历每个命令扩展名或删除命令扩展名。
TEST ONE TWO
查看英文版
systemroot | systeminfo | sys | switches | sc | subst | start | sort | smartdrv | shutdown | share | sfc | setver | setlocal | set | scandisk | scanreg | schtasks |
未知的网友